Ubuntu18.04/19.04/20.04安装笔记&&通用指南

 使用集成显卡安装Ubuntu能减少麻烦,很多Nvidia独立显卡设备无法成功安装使用Ubuntu的原因在于,Ubuntu默认使用Noveau显卡驱动造成的兼容性问题,本文从这一点出发,能解决大多数同类型显卡设备的问题。

设备配置:
  微星 GL62M 7REX-1650CN
  CPU i7-7700HQ
  NVIDIA GeForce GTX 1050Ti
  128SSD+1THDD

1.制作U盘启动盘

  建议使用Etcher刷写Linux镜像。
  Etcher是一款开源的跨平台的系统级刷写工具,支持Windows,Linux,Mac OS。
  使用Etcher将Ubuntu 19.04 Desktop ISO刷写进U盘中

2. 安装系统

2.1安装前准备

  • 关闭安全启动:Secure Boot设置为Disable
  • Startup->设置为Network Boot为USB HDD
  • 启动方式设置为UEFI Only
  • 在Startup Boot中将USB HDD设为第一启动项
  • F10保存所有设置并重启,进入U盘安装

总的来讲,需要禁用安全启动以及在启动电脑时进行U盘启动即可,这一安装步骤仅供参考。

2.2. 安装

由于安装时缺省使用Canonical提供的Nouveau显卡驱动,这个驱动在很多机器上存在兼容性问题,易卡死在Ubuntu安装界面,因此,首先需要禁用Nouveau,使用机器自带的集成显卡进入安装程序,并在Ubuntu系统内安装并启用Nvidia显卡驱动

  • 插入U盘,启动电脑,进入grub界面,光标移动到Install Ubuntu条目,键盘按e键进入编辑模式,在”quite splash”后先空格,再键入”nomodeset”,按F10保存,进入Ubuntu19.04安装系统

    2.3. 分区方案

  • 本人安装模式为Ubuntu单系统,128SSD+1THDD,8G+8G RAM双通道
  • /swap交换空间 16G(至少为内存的1倍) SSD;
  • /boot  500MB SSD
  • /EFI   500MB SSD
  • /     剩余SSD
  • /home  1T HDD

    2.3. 双系统

    若是Windows + Ubuntu 双系统安装,重新启动后,将进入grub引导界面:选中第一个启动选项Ubuntu,按e进入编辑模式,找到”quite splash”,删除其后的一小段文字,空格,键入”nomodeset”,F10保存,进入Ubuntu。
    若为单系统安装,请忽略此条目。

    3.禁用Nouveau

    重启后进入登录界面,不要登录,Ctrl+Alt+F2/F3/F4...从图形化界面切换到文本界面(Ctrl+Alt+F1从文本界面切换到图形化界面),输入命令:
    1
    sudo nano  /etc/modprobe.d/blacklist.conf
    在打开的文件末尾输入”blacklist nouveau” ,Ctrl+x退出,键入y确定更改,回车,返回到了Terminal,并输入:sudo update-initramfs -u使修改生效以禁用Nouveau驱动,然后重启。

    4.安装Nvidia驱动

     4.1 自动安装驱动

  • 找到并打开软件和更新程序,在附加驱动页面,选择第一个选项,应用更改,等待下载安装完毕
    软件和更新

    4.2 手动安装驱动

    NVIDIA驱动程序官网,根据显卡的具体型号查找安装包,下载后 sudo chmod 777 xxx.run 给予权限,运行安装,安装过程中会有一些问题,自行查询。
    在这里插入图片描述